Anniara Muñoz Carrazana (born January 24, 1980) is a Cuban volleyball player who competed with the Cuba women's national volleyball team at the 2004 Summer Olympics winning the bronze medal. She also competed at the 2002 FIVB Volleyball Women's World Championship in Germany.[1] On club level she played with Cienfuegos.
